
NPN RF Bipolar Junction Transistor (BJT) in SOT-343 surface mount package. Features a maximum collector-emitter voltage of 4.5V, continuous collector current of 35mA, and a transition frequency of 25GHz. Offers a minimum gain (hFE) of 60 and a gain of 21dB at 25GHz. Operates within a temperature range of -65°C to 150°C with a maximum power dissipation of 160mW. RoHS compliant and lead-free.
